Lunar New Year: Ways to Celebrate the Year of the Dragon
Are you ready to celebrate the Lunar New Year and welcome the Year of the Dragon in February 2024? This traditional Chinese holiday, also known as the Spring Festival, is a time for families to come together, enjoy delicious food, and partake in various cultural activities. Whether you have Chinese heritage or simply want to join in the festivities, there are plenty of ways to celebrate this special occasion.
Here are some fun and meaningful ways to mark the Lunar New Year and embrace the year of the Dragon:
- Attend a Dragon Dance Performance: Look for local parades or performances featuring colorful dragon dancers, as these are a significant part of Lunar New Year celebrations.
- Prepare Lucky Foods: Dive into the culinary traditions of the Lunar New Year by cooking or enjoying dishes believed to bring luck and prosperity, such as dumplings, fish, and noodles.
- Create Red Decorations: Red is a symbol of good luck in Chinese culture, so consider decorating your home with red lanterns, banners, and ornaments to bring in positive energy for the year ahead.
Black History Month: Ways to Honor and Celebrate African-American Contributions
Black History Month is a time to celebrate and honor the incredible contributions of African-Americans to our society. It’s a time to reflect on the struggles and triumphs of the African-American community, and to recognize the impact they have had on our culture, our history, and our world. There are many ways to honor and celebrate Black History Month, and here are a few ideas to get you started:
- Visit a museum or historical site dedicated to African-American history
- Read a book by an African-American author
- Watch a documentary or film that highlights the achievements of African-Americans
- Attend a cultural event or celebration in your community
These are just a few ideas to help you honor and celebrate Black History Month, but there are countless other ways to recognize the contributions of African-Americans. Whether it’s through education, advocacy, or simply taking the time to listen to the stories of the African-American community, every effort helps to acknowledge and celebrate their impact on our world.
